>This sounds like a great idea. However, my suggestion would be that for a private datasession, THAT is what would happen by default UNLESS you specify a new setting. This way, no code would even be necessary to add to your baseclass if what you want is the way the application was defined for all your private datasessions, you'd only change the settings as needed. The private datasessions would "inherit" the default sessions settings.
That would work only if that behavior could be turned on and off -- if it became the automatic and unchangeable behavior, it would break too much existing code that depends on the current way.
